Reviewer notes: Brindle Cache Layer. The bloom filter sits in front of the Kestrelview KV store to short-circuit lookups for absent keys; review any change to hash count or bit-array sizing carefully, since false-positive rates cascade into backend load. Merged changes trigger an automatic signed deploy to staging, and that pipeline authenticates with the deploy key below.

rollout seal: bky4_yke3

Minutes — Support Outsourcing Sync, Brightmoor Software

Quick recap for the sales leads: we met with Toralee Services about taking over tier-1 support for the Plumeline product. Their trial metrics looked solid — faster first response, decent satisfaction scores. Jonas flagged the handoff risk for enterprise accounts, so those stay in-house for now. Rollout target is next quarter, pending contract review. Please keep client messaging neutral until we announce. The confidential commercial context follows directly below.

board note of fahif-yahog: Gross margin on Wenath came in at 10 percent against a plan of 5 percent. Only 3 of the 100 pilot accounts renewed Wenath, so a churn review is set for July 15.

**Q: Why are some records behaving differently after the Brackenfield ORM refactor?**

The legacy ORM layer in Brackenfield is being replaced module by module, so a few entities now use the new query engine while others still route through the old mapper. Minor timing and ordering differences are expected during the transition. Check the migration status page before filing a ticket. If a customer reports data inconsistencies, escalate to the data platform team at the address below.

billing contact of kajof-kahap = quenix@tolvaqworks.internal